Description
A sweet and savory twist on the classic grilled cheese, featuring melted cheese with thinly sliced pears and apples, toasted to golden perfection. Perfect for brunch, lunch, or a comforting snack, this sandwich pairs beautifully with honey, mustard, or a light balsamic drizzle.
Ingredients
🛒 Ingredients (for 2 sandwiches):
For the Sandwich:
2 tablespoons butter, softened
4 slices of bread (sourdough, whole grain, or your choice)
4 oz cheese (Gruyère, cheddar, or brie), sliced
1 small pear, thinly sliced
1 small apple, thinly sliced
Optional: 1 teaspoon honey or fig jam
Optional: 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
Instructions
📝 Instructions:
Step 1: Prepare Ingredients
Wash and thinly slice the pear and apple. Slice the cheese if not pre-sliced.
Step 2: Assemble Sandwich
Spread butter on one side of each bread slice. On the unbuttered side, layer cheese, pear slices, and apple slices. Add honey or mustard if desired. Top with another slice of bread, buttered side facing out.
Step 3: Cook Sandwich
Heat a skillet over medium heat. Place the sandwich in the pan and cook 3–4 minutes per side, or until the bread is golden brown and the cheese is melted. Press lightly with a spatula for even toasting.
Step 4: Serve
Remove from skillet, slice in half, and serve immediately. Optional: drizzle lightly with balsamic reduction or serve with a side salad.
Notes
- Cheese Tip: Gruyère gives a nutty flavor, while brie adds creaminess. Cheddar gives a classic sharp taste.
- Fruit Tip: Choose ripe but firm pears and apples to avoid sogginess.
- Make Ahead: Slice the fruit in advance and store in a lemon-water solution to prevent browning.
- Variations: Add a few arugula leaves or caramelized onions for extra flavor.
